Maja e Malthit
Maja e Malthit is a peak in Komuna e Oroshit, Mirdita, Lezhë County and has an elevation of 760 metres. Maja e Malthit is situated nearby to the locality Vau i Madh, as well as near the village Peshqesh.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Reps
Village
Reps is a small town in the Lezhë County, northwestern Albania. At the 2015 local government reform it became part of the municipality Mirditë. It was the seat of the former municipality Orosh. The Vandrushen chromium mines are 4 km outside the village centre. Reps is situated 7 km northeast of Maja e Malthit.
